How long does it take for pre-workout to wear off?

Most pre-workout effects last at least 2 hours. This varies by ingredient. For example, the increased blood flow from arginine may wear off in 1โ€“2 hours, while the energy boost you may get from caffeine can take 6 hours or more to wear off.

Can too much pre-workout hurt you?

A 2019 study into people who regularly consume pre-workout found that 54% of participants reported side effects, including nausea, skin reactions, and heart abnormalities. However, the research adds that these side effects are likely more common in those who consume more than the recommended serving size.

How long do side effects of pre-workout last?

Most ingredients in pre-workout have a half-life of 4-6 hours. That means the pre-workout will last and remain in your system for about 4 hours; however, you may only feel the effects for an hour or two. Caffeine, for example, takes about 30 minutes to kick-in with around 1 to 1.5 hours until peak time.

What happens when you take 8 scoops of pre-workout?

“The combination of huge amounts of caffeine and beta phenylethylamine in eight scoops of pre-workout swallowed all at once, with heavy lifting, all together could have increased JA’s blood pressure so high that it caused his brain to start to stroke in the form of a bleed,” explained Hsu.

Can Preworkout cause stroke?

Hemorrhagic stroke is a catastrophic medical emergency with several modifiable risk factors. Preworkout supplementation can contribute to the risk of hemorrhagic stroke, and this case represents the fourth report in the literature of hemorrhagic stroke associated with preworkout supplementation.

Is it bad to dry scoop pre-workout?

“Dry scooping” is a TikTok trend encouraging people to take pre-workout powders without water. This practice is very dangerous and may result in some potentially serious health effects, including heart palpitations, lung irritation or infection, and digestive issues.

Why does pre-workout make you tingle?

This itchiness or tingling skin is caused by an ingredient called Beta-Alanine. Pre-workout products which feature this ingredient, especially in doses higher than 2g per serve, will most likely cause this sensation. This is due to Beta-Alanine causing acute paresthesia.
